Type
ORACLE
Validation date
2024-05-30 04:46: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01946,
    "usd": 0.02101
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00017BAEAB86610405056AC465A1044934AE49DE014D3B59893EC8F0116A09974698

Previous signature

E225A44EC8E162BEFB3C30CE2C1F5DA512207E8759C887A37E7B595C2E0F4D38E1A11AF1CB956C3B0E3DDA95BF3A6B3A1AD4D42C6587A6D5E70F1249B43A360E

Origin signature

3045022100AA87DE3E3262A386C65208C04D93430D9419C871F2903CC8F59EDA842E645EA0022078D3FD88A4E33BDEB55351F901BCD3A3D4CD9EF038046DB1387A91514E2C3A06

Proof of work

010204B3B2A53580086B9F36919CF40ABC55904729F78BF43673E216FAC1EB2451DD1E521879C6588F0CB09B150A103A39A73E2816B5ADF51F0721348BA3A66C33023B

Proof of integrity

00404994F9B6ACAB84179A6EB6997E76CB6D451ECAD1295F6071C56EB36E74C33A

Coordinator signature

A3557E2F24FA41CE85C0DBA8A20C4404949FF3DEB3A7ED7A0EC7268CEE4EE152D259992B389453F081FBE94B28055CDC93EBDFAAEF176AD3230822CC07653901

Validator #1 public key

00011ED0B570D680BE5ECD58D2D121689DA73C46DCB38A01C6E10D06286040ADE30A

Validator #1 signature

84414136D8AF36ED626EB16B888E45672A925D2ACC32C21BB81C0A4DA0EDEB331500E8FFAF7F4E95EF32DC3570F8610A2AFBB633D38C68C91BE2F9259F2B3401

Validator #2 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#2 signature

348A0BACE48A35481368F4A7CF0CA091E611410FE5F72C47418EE91CEE972C954E32B4813ECED283228B956D47D8E72FECA2F5A6B832AED23EA3D4DA3561160A